Hudson Valley Community College men's lacrosse (8-4) dropped their regular season finale to Onondaga 18-2 on Saturday afternoon in Syracuse, NY. 

The No. 3 ranked Onondaga Lazers jumped out to a 9-0 lead before Hudson Valley was able to get on the board. Nicholas Malatesta (North Greenbush/Averill Park) found the back of the net with 3:56 remaining in the first half. Stephen Gnat recorded the assist on Malatesta's goal. 

Nathan Bruce (Scotia/Scotia-Glenville) tallied the second Vikings goal with an unassisted shot with 3:10 remaining in the third quarter. 

The Vikings men's lacrosse program will learn its postseason ranking this week and is expected to land the No. 3 seed in the 2019 Regional Tournament. Hudson Valley will host the No. 6 seed on Wednesday, May 1 at the Vikings Outdoor Athletic Complex.
